ASTRONOMY

DO THE LOMINOUS INFRARED GALAXIES-LIRGs- FOLLOW THE HUBBLE LAW?

Yesenia M. Rivera; Antonio Lucchetti Vocational High School, Arecibo,
Puerto Rico
Harrison Rivera ColСn; Antonio Lucchetti Vocational High School,
Arecibo, Puerto Rico

Research Mentor: Dr. Tapasi Ghosh, Arecibo Observatory, Arecibo, Puerto
Rico

All of the galaxies in the Universe emit some kind of light, some more or
less than others. In this research, those galaxies that emit their most
intense light in the infrared band were studied. These are called Luminous
Infrared Galaxies (LIRGs). The goal of this research was to inquire if,
like normal galaxies, LIRGs also follows Hubble's law. In 1929, Edwin
Hubble noted that the further away a galaxy was, the faster it was moving
away. This can be expressed as V=H0D and is called Hubble's Law. The
recessional velocities of the galaxies in the sample of LIRGs in this study
were derived from the observations of (redshifted) neutral hydrogen (HI)
spectra, and the application of the Doppler Effect. An independent
indication of their distances was obtained from their apparent angular
sizes, as gathered from the literature. The velocities obtained from the HI
spectra were plotted against the angular sizes of these Galaxies, and an
exploration was made whether or not the Hubble law is followed by the
galaxies in this sample.
